The grinding setting is too fine or the pre-ground coffee is too fine.Īdjust the grinding unit to a coarser setting or use coars- er pre-ground coffee.ĭisplay shows Error Please contact HOTLINE The grinding setting is too coarse or the pre-ground coffee is too coarse.Īdjust the grinding unit to a finer setting or use finer pre- ground coffee. ![]() The grinding setting is not suitable for the beans. Use a type of coffee with a higher proportion of robusta beans. Pre-ground coffee is too fine.Īdjust the grinding unit to a coarser setting. Coffee dispensing slows to a trickle or stops completely.Ĭoffee is ground too finely. The selected per-cup quantity is not reached.
